Martha Alta Hensley Proffitt

Martha Alta Hensley Proffitt, age 92, passed away June 18, 2022 at Skyland Care Center in Sylva with her husband of nearly 72 years by her side.

Martha was born June 13, 1930 to the late Furman and Alice Hensley of the Swiss Community in Yancey County.  She was preceded in death by two sisters, Lola Hughes and Myrtle Dulaney of Burnsville, and a brother, Glen Hensley of Hickory.

A sweet and beloved lady with a tender, compassionate heart, Martha was an example of Godly love always putting the needs and wishes of others above her own.  She will be remembered for her caring spirit, sweet smile, and contagious laugh.

Martha was a virtuous woman of great faith and a member of Faith Baptist Church.  She loved children, reading, and quilting.

Her beautiful life will forever be cherished in the lives of her children, grandchildren, and great grandchildren by whom she was deeply loved.

Martha is survived by her husband C.L. Proffitt; one sister; Grace Patrick of Zephyrhills, Fla. five children, Danny Proffitt (Glenda) of Memphis, TN, Dennis Proffitt (Pat) of Sylva, Debbie Keisler of Wesley Chapel, FL, David Proffitt (Christy) of Sylva, and Darrell Proffitt (Julia) of Asheville; grandchildren, Anthony Proffitt, Stephanie Kesner (Bobby), Cassie McAbee (Brad), Blake Proffitt (Felicia), Brady Proffitt, Megan Robitaille (Nichlaus), Lindsey Smathers (Josh), Josh Proffitt, Chloe Proffitt, Madison Proffitt; and numerous great grandchildren whom she loved.

The family would like to thank Carmela Brooks, a very special caregiver, for her love and companionship; also, the wonderful staff members at the Jackson County Adult Day Program, Dr. Balta’s office, Hospice, and Skyland Care Center.

A Funeral Service was held on Wednesday, June 22nd at Appalachian Funeral Home.  Pastors Peter Mudge and J.D. Grant officiated.  A graveside service was held afterward at Fairview Memorial Garden.
